Xiangqi-lisp By Sean Yeh A simple CLI xiangqi (Chinese chess) game for player vs. player. I originally intended to write this as a fun way to review lisp the day before an AI quiz at school; I wrote the bulk of this that day, and later went back to make it prettier and more user-friendly (relatively!). An important note: Because this was written primarily for myself, I went with the move notation system that seemed most intuitive for me rather than the standard one(s). old-position new-position (e.g. h2e2 for the common cannon opening) I may or may not look into the standard notation(s) in the future.
